Understanding Building And Construction Audit



In the world of building, comprehending accounting practices is necessary for efficient job administration and economic oversight (construction accounting). Building audit stands out from standard accounting as a result of its unique difficulties, consisting of project-based monetary tracking, complex cost frameworks, and the requirement for conformity with different laws. This customized field stresses the importance of precisely assigning prices to details jobs, enabling specialists to assess earnings and make educated budgeting decisions


Among the primary elements of building audit is work setting you back, which involves tracking all expenses linked with a specific task. This includes labor, materials, and expenses prices. By maintaining in-depth records, building companies can obtain understandings into the monetary wellness of their projects, determining potential issues prior to they intensify.


Furthermore, building accounting calls for a grasp of progress invoicing, which allows service providers to invoice customers based on the job finished instead than full project completion. This approach improves money circulation monitoring and lines up billing with task milestones. Ultimately, a strong understanding of construction accountancy methods encourages job managers and stakeholders to make strategic decisions, ensuring the monetary security and success of building ventures.


Trick Financial Metrics to Track





Tracking crucial economic metrics is essential for building companies to preserve control over their tasks and overall organization performance. Among the most crucial metrics are the Gross Earnings Margin and Internet Profit Margin, which give insight into earnings and cost administration. The Gross Revenue Margin, determined by subtracting the cost of products offered from overall income, helps evaluate project efficiency.


An additional crucial metric is the Existing Ratio, which evaluates a firm's ability to meet short-term responsibilities with its existing possessions. A proportion over 1 suggests financial stability. Furthermore, tracking the Accounts Receivable Turnover Ratio can disclose exactly how effectively a business accumulates settlements, with a greater ratio showing prompt collections.


Job Costing is additionally vital; it entails assessing the real prices sustained against the allocated prices for particular tasks, permitting firms to identify discrepancies and readjust techniques accordingly. Lastly, the Stockpile metric measures the worth of job got yet not yet completed, giving understanding right into future profits possibility.


Reliable Budgeting Strategies



Reliable budgeting methods are essential for construction companies looking for to enhance job outcomes and keep monetary health. A well-structured budget plan functions as a roadmap, leading task next managers with the intricacies of building costs and source allotment.

To produce an efficient spending plan, begin by developing an in-depth scope of work, which lays out all jobs and materials required for the job. This structure allows for precise expense evaluations. Use historical data from previous tasks to benchmark costs and identify possible variations.


Include contingency allowances into the budget plan to represent unforeseen expenditures, making sure that tasks remain financially viable regardless of uncertainties. Furthermore, include all stakeholders in the budgeting procedure, promoting collaboration and enhancing responsibility.




Frequently screen and change the budget plan throughout the project lifecycle. Implementing a regular evaluation procedure enables prompt recognition of deviations and promotes rehabilitative actions. Tracking costs versus the spending plan in real-time can help mitigate expense overruns and enhance financial efficiency.
